when i turn my steering wheel left or right from the straight position it makes a loud clicking noise from somewher upfront, been at the shop several times cant find the problem, all the ball joint are good, and some are new, but cant find the loud clicking, any ideas what to check? *(96 dodge ram 1500 4x4)
Are you moving when you hear the noise or sitting still and turning the wheel?
Are you in 2h or 4h or 4l?
Do you have a lift?
Is it just one click as opposed to several or a clunk?
Do you feel it or only hear it?
when im standing it makes noise pretty much or if im driving under 5 mph, im in 2h(rear wheel drive only), no only 1 clunk each way i turn left or right, no lift, and i only hear it dont feel anything, ujoint were checked and are good,
Have you ever replaced your track bar? Have you checked all of your steering joints? Have you tried to move the intermediate steering shaft from under the hood? Is there a lot of play in your steering wheel? Do you have wheel spacers?
yes track bar is new, steering joints all seem fine, ye i tried to move the steering joint under the hood and there is no play, and there is no play in my steering wheel, when i touch it a little my wheels turn so there is 0% play, no wheel spacers
Got me stumped. Take a really really good look around all of the frame mounting points for the steering box, spring hangers, etc. Make sure nothing is cracked. Maybe something in the steering box. See if you can get someone to help you. Have them turn the wheel with it in Park and put your hand on different things to see if you can feel the click somewhere.
Change your wheel u-joints. I know you checked them but if you didn't pull them apart you don't know for sure. Mine looked fine and had no play in them but once they were apart the grease was gone and they were full of rust(shot)
